CARIBBEAN RICE

Make and share this Caribbean Rice rec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ratherbeswimmin

Categories     Long Grain Rice

Time 1h6m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11



Caribbean Rice image

Steps:

  • Bring broth and coconut milk to a boil in a medium-size pan over med-high heat; add in rice.
  • Cover, decrease heat, and simmer 20 minutes, or until liquid is absorbed; remove from heat and keep warm.
  • Heat oil in a nonstick skillet over med-high heat; add in onion; stir/saute 5 minutes.
  • Decrease heat to medium; add in squash; cook 8 minutes or until tender, stirring occasionally.
  • Stir in thyme and remaining ingredients; cook 3 minutes or until heated through, stirring occasionally.
  • Add rice to squash mixture, stirring to combine; serve.

1 1/4 cups fat-free chicken broth
1 cup light coconut milk
1 cup long grain rice (Uncle Ben's)
1 teaspoon olive oil
1 cup chopped onion
1 3/4 cups cubed peeled butternut squash
1 teaspoon chopped fresh thyme (or 1/4 t. dried)
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ground turmeric
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 (15 ounce) can black beans, rinsed and drained

CARIBBEAN RICE AND BEANS

Provided by Robert Irvine :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 45m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12



Caribbean Rice and Beans image

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a large skillet. Gently saute onions, garlic and hot peppers, then add beans and vinegar and cook for about 5 minutes. Add the rice to the beans, then stir in stock, reduce heat, and simmer until rice is cooked, about 15 to 20 minutes. Stir in parsley, chives, hot sauce, salt, and pepper and serve.

1/4 cup vegetable oil
1 large onion, chopped
2 cloves garlic, chopped
1/2 Scotch bonnet pepper, seeded and diced (while handling, protect your hands and eyes, and avoid breathing fumes)
2 (16-ounce) cans black beans (or your choice of beans), rinsed clean
2 tablespoons rice wine vinegar
1 cup dry rice
2 cups chicken or vegetable stock
2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ley leaves
1 tablespoon chopped chives
Hot sauce, to taste (recommended: Tabasco)
Salt and freshly ground black pepper

CARIBBEAN COCONUT RICE

This fragrant coconut rice pilaf goes especially well with Indian, Asian, and Caribbean entrées. It's so good and so simple, though, you'll probably find yourself making it often to accompany weeknight meals.

Provided by JenniH76

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 12



Caribbean Coconut Rice image

Steps:

  • Melt butter in saucepan over medium heat. Add ginger, garlic, and cinnamon stick, and sauté until fragrant, about 1 minute. Stir in rice, and sauté until rice grains are opaque, about 2 minutes. Add water, coconut milk, sugar, salt, lime zest, and white pepper and bring to a simmer. Stir once, cover, reduce heat to low, and simmer for 15 minutes.
  • Fluff rice with a fork, cover, and let rest for 5 minutes. Garnish with toasted coconut, if using.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 277.1 calories, Carbohydrate 42.9 g, Cholesterol 5.1 mg, Fat 9.7 g, Fiber 2.1 g, Protein 4.1 g, SaturatedFat 7 g, Sodium 248.9 mg, Sugar 1.5 g

2 teaspoons unsalted butter
2 teaspoons minced fresh ginger
1 clove garlic, minced
1 (3 inch) cinnamon stick
1 cup uncooked jasmine rice
¾ cup water
¾ cup light coconut milk
1 teaspoon white sugar
½ teaspoon kosher salt
¼ teaspoon grated lime zest
⅛ teaspoon ground white pepper
¼ cup shredded unsweetened coconut, toasted

CARIBBEAN RICE

In the Caribbean, coconut, mango, and rice are staples. They appear on menus in all kinds of forms. Combine them all in the same dish and you have something special. The sweetness of the mango and coconut makes this dish suitable for curries, chicken, fish , and pork, all common Caribbean ingredients. Enjoy!

Provided by Normaone

Categories     Mango

Time 40m

Yield 8-10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7



Caribbean Rice image

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large saucepan and add coconut.
  • Cook, stirring constantly until very lightly browned Add minced onion.
  • Continue cooking and stirring 1 minute longer.
  • Add rice, stir to coat.
  • Add broth and bring to a boil.
  • Cover and reduce heat to low.
  • Simmer 25 to 30 minutes until rice is tender.
  • Remove from heat and stir in mango.
  • Sprinkle with chives.

2 teaspoons oil
3/4 cup shredded coconut
1/2 cup onion, minced
2 cups rice
4 cups chicken broth
1 firm ripe mango, peeled and cubed
1/4 cup fresh chives, minced
